Energy efficiency
If you're considering buying a 50 50 under counter fridge freezer that's energy efficient, ensure that the model you select has an ENERGY STAR label. This means the appliance is at minimum 10 percent more efficient than the federal standard. These refrigerators are available in different sizes styles, styles, and capacities. Some models are small while others can house a full-size fridge, ice maker and more.

You can also use a device such as a Kill A Watt meter to determine the amount of electricity consumed by your refrigerator. Install the meter into a socket close to your refrigerator and leave it there for a few days. Then, divide the fridge's running wattage by your power provider's price per kwh to determine the amount of energy consumed and the cost.

Installation
A fridge freezer on the counter can be an fantastic addition to your kitchen. It can help keep food and drinks at the perfect temperature, so you can serve your guests. It also allows you to free up space in your refrigerator, making it easier to store food items. You can even find models that have separate compartments for refrigeration and freezing.
The best undercounter refrigerator freezers are easy-to-install and maintain. Be sure to leave enough space between the cabinet and fridge under it to allow for air circulation. It is also recommended to leave a half inch of space on each side to ensure that the fridge can properly vent. Cleaning your refrigerator's undercounter freezer is vital. This includes wiping down the surfaces and sanitizing drawers. You can clean the interior or exterior with a weak bleach solution or soap and water.
